北大青鸟Linux课件NFS文件系统.ppt

上传人:xt****7 文档编号:6319256 上传时间:2020-02-22 格式:PPT 页数:34 大小:1.51MB
返回 下载 相关 举报
北大青鸟Linux课件NFS文件系统.ppt_第1页
第1页 / 共34页
北大青鸟Linux课件NFS文件系统.ppt_第2页
第2页 / 共34页
北大青鸟Linux课件NFS文件系统.ppt_第3页
第3页 / 共34页
点击查看更多>>
资源描述
Page1 34 第7章内容回顾 网络信息查看与设置命令ifconfigroutepingtraceroutehostnamenslookup配置文件网络设置netconfig配置工具ifcfg eth0文件hosts文件resolv conf文件 NFS文件系统 第8章 Page3 34 本章目标 掌握NFS服务器的安装 配置和使用掌握NFS客户端的配置掌握挂载和卸载共享目录 Page4 34 本章结构 Page5 34 NFS的基本概念 NFS是系统间进行文件共享的一种网络协议在NFS的应用结构中有服务器和客户机两种角色NFS客户端通过挂载NFS文件系统的方式访问NFS服务器中输出的共享目录在同一台主机中即可以是NFS服务器也可以作为NFS客户机 Page6 34 NFS网络共享的一般用法 在NFS服务器主机中进行设置安装NFS服务器软件包启动NFS服务器程序设置NFS共享目录输出在NFS客户机中进行设置使用mount命令挂载NFS服务器中的NFS共享目录到文件系统中通过NFS文件系统的挂载点目录访问NFS服务器中的共享内容 Page7 34 NFS服务器的安装 portmap软件包提供了运行portmap服务所需的文件 portmap服务为NFS等服务器程序提供RPC服务的支持nfs utils软件包提供了NFS服务器的启动脚本和管理维护工具软件包安装 nfs utils 和 portmap 两个软件包在RHEL4系统中是默认安装的 Page8 34 NFS服务器的配置文件 exports 文件用于配置NFS服务器中输出的共享目录 cat etc exports home share sync ro Page9 34 exports文件解析2 1 exports文件中 客户端主机地址 字段可以使用多种形式表示主机地址 Page10 34 exports文件解析2 2 exports文件中的 配置选项 字段放置在括号对 中 多个选项间用逗号分隔sync 设置NFS服务器同步写磁盘 这样不会轻易丢失数据 建议所有的NFS共享目录都使用该选项ro 设置输出的共享目录只读 与rw不能共同使用rw 设置输出的共享目录可读写 与ro不能共同使用 Page11 34 exports文件配置实例 配置NFS服务器输出的共享目录输出 home share 目录 对所有主机可读 对地址为192 168 1 19的主机可读可写输出 home pub 目录 对192 168 152 0子网内的所有主机可读 cat etc exports home share sync ro 192 168 1 19 sync rw home pub192 168 152 0 24 sync ro Page12 34 NFS服务器的启动与停止 查询服务器的状态为了保证NFS服务器能够正常工作 系统中需要运行portmap和nfs两个服务程序 serviceportmapstatus servicenfsstatus启动服务器 serviceportmapstart servicenfsstart停止服务器运行 servicenfsstop Page13 34 showmount命令3 1 showmount命令的帮助信息showmount命令用于查询显示NFS服务器的相关信息 showmount helpUsage showmount adehv all directories exports no headers help version host 显示主机的NFS服务器信息显示当前主机中NFS服务器的连接信息 showmount显示指定主机中NFS服务器的连接信息 showmount192 168 152 131 Page14 34 showmount命令3 2 显示NFS服务器的输出目录列表显示当前主机中NFS服务器的输出列表 showmount e显示指定NFS服务器中的共享目录列表 showmount e192 168 152 131显示NFS服务器中被挂载的共享目录显示当前主机NFS服务器中已经被NFS客户机挂载使用的共享目录 showmount d Page15 34 showmount命令3 3 显示NFS服务器的客户机与被挂载的目录显示当前主机中NFS服务器的客户机信息 showmount a显示指定主机中NFS服务器的客户机信息 showmount a192 168 152 131 Page16 34 exportfs命令 重新输出共享目录使nfs服务器重新读取exports文件中的设置 exportfs rv停止输出所有目录停止当前主机中NFS服务器的所有目录输出 exportfs auv输出 启用 所有目录输出当前主机中NFS服务器的所有共享目录 showmount e Page17 34 启动NFS服务器配置工具 可使用命令和菜单两种方式启动NFS配置工具 system config nfs 选择菜单启动NFS配置工具 启动NFS配置工具需要root权限 Page18 34 NFS服务器配置工具界面 exports文件中配置的内容将显示在管理工具的窗口中 选择已有配置记录并选择 Properties 按钮 编辑共享目录的设置属性 在NFS配置工具中可进行共享目录属性的设置 Page19 34 阶段总结 NFS是进行文件共享的网络协议在RHEL4系统中NFS服务器程序和管理工具是默认安装的NFS服务器通过exports文件配置共享目录输出和目录的访问权限showmount命令用于查询显示NFS服务器的相关信息exportfs命令用于对 exports 文件设置的共享目录进行管理 Page20 34 阶段练习 查看并分析exports文件中配置记录的格式使用showmount命令查看NFS服务器中输出的共享目录 Page21 34 Linux客户端挂载NFS文件系统 显示NFS服务器的输出 showmount e192 168 152 131挂载NFS服务器中的共享目录 mount tnfs 192 168 152 131 home share mnt Page22 34 卸载NFS文件系统 显示当前主机挂载的NFS共享目录使用mount命令查看 mount grepnfs192 168 152 131 home share on mnttypenfs rw addr 192 168 152 131 卸载系统中已挂载的NFS共享目录使用umount命令卸载NFS文件系统 umount mnt Page23 34 系统启动时自动挂载NFS文件系 将NFS的共享目录挂载信息写入 etc fstab 文件 可实现对NFS共享目录的自动挂载 tail 1 etc fstab192 168 152 131 home pub mntnfsdefaults00 Page24 34 在Windows中使用NFS客户端 Windows操作系统中可以通过安装NFS客户端软件实现对NFS服务器的访问OmniLiteOmniLite是比较常用的Windows操作系统中运行的NFS客户端软件OmniLite是商业软件 可以下载并进行试用ftp Page25 34 OmniLite使用步骤 启动NFSClient程序设置NFS服务器主机记录定义NFS驱动器的连接挂载NFS驱动器使用NFS网络驱动器卸载NFS驱动器 Page26 34 OmniLite的运行与配置 启动NFSClient程序在Windows操作系统中选择 开始 程序 Omni LiteV4 13 菜单 并选择 NFSClient 程序项启动NFS客户端程序 选择HOSTEDIT按钮 选择 New 菜单项添加一个指向LinuxNFS服务器的主机记录 Page27 34 配置NFS驱动器 定义NFS驱动器的连接 选择DEFINE按钮 选择Browse按钮 选择需要挂载的NFS共享目录输出路径 选择下一步按钮 设置UID和GID 已经配置完成的NFS驱动器 Page28 34 挂载NFS驱动器 选择已经配置完成的NFS驱动器 并选择 MOUNT 按钮 NFS驱动器成功挂载后盘符左边的图标将由黄色变为绿色 表示NFS驱动器已经挂载的状态 在NFSClient程序中挂载已定义的共享目录 Page29 34 使用NFS网络驱动器 NFS驱动器盘符 通过NFS驱动器访问共享目录Windows操作系统的 我的电脑 中出现NFS驱动器对应的盘符 用户可以象访问Windows的本地磁盘一样访问NFS驱动器 Page30 34 卸载NFS驱动器 选择UNMNT按钮卸载NFS驱动器 在NFSClient程序中卸载已经挂载的网络驱动器 Page31 34 阶段总结 在Linux系统中使用mount命令可以将NFS服务器中的共享目录挂载到文件系统中Linux系统中已挂载的NFS文件系统可通过挂载点目录进行访问在Windows系统中需要安装第三方的软件实现NFS服务器共享目录的访问OmniLite是Windows下较常用的NFS客户端软件OmniLite通过将NFS共享目录映射为Windows中的网络驱动器来访问NFS服务器 Page32 34 阶段练习 使用mount命令挂载NFS文件系统查看系统中已挂载的NFS文件系统的信息 Page33 34 本章总结 NFS文件系统概述 NFS服务器的安装 NFS服务器的配置文件 在Linux中配置使用NFS客户端 在Windows中配置使用NFS客户端 showmount命令 exportfs命令 NFS服务器配置工具 NFS服务器的启动与停止 NFS是UNIX系统间常用的文件共享网络协议 需要安装 nfs utils 和 portmap 两个软件包 exports文件用于配置NFS服务器的共享目录输出 运行portmap和nfs两个系统服务程序 showmount命令用于查询显示NFS服务器的相关信息 exportfs命令用于对输出的NFS共享目录进行管理 RHEL4中提供了图形界面的NFS服务器配置工具 通过mount命令挂载nfs文件系统 通过安装第三方软件建立NFS网络驱动器 Page34 34 任务1 注意事项提示1 在进行NFS服务器访问的实验中 应注意NFS服务器端的网络防火墙的访问策略是否允许进行nfs网络服务的访问在实验中可暂时关闭NFS服务器主机中的iptables网络防火墙服务 serviceiptablesstop
展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 图纸专区 > 课件教案


copyright@ 2023-2025  zhuangpeitu.com 装配图网版权所有   联系电话:18123376007

备案号:ICP2024067431-1 川公网安备51140202000466号


本站为文档C2C交易模式,即用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。装配图网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知装配图网,我们立即给予删除!